Merge pull request #12844 from amq/patch-3

Add invalid data case to tdbstore ram init
pull/12866/head
Martin Kojtal 2020-04-24 10:11:28 +02:00 committed by GitHub
commit 4b5f34a1ea
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23
1 changed files with 1 additions and 1 deletions

View File

@ -937,7 +937,7 @@ int TDBStore::build_ram_table()
_num_keys = 0;
offset = _master_record_offset;
while (offset < _free_space_offset) {
while (offset + sizeof(record_header_t) < _free_space_offset) {
ret = read_record(_active_area, offset, _key_buf, 0, 0, actual_data_size, 0,
true, false, false, true, hash, flags, next_offset);